Transaction 8699dc0686dedcae3a279dfe690905a452b98d7002a2f8f64b5ba06628829916

6 Input
2 Outputs
  • 8699dc0686dedcae3a279dfe690905a452b98d7002a2f8f64b5ba06628829916:0
  • value  1329437
    address  bc1q2hcna4kq39af0cu5lmwj6x8lk40lxkd944fnyu
  • 8699dc0686dedcae3a279dfe690905a452b98d7002a2f8f64b5ba06628829916:1
  • value  12331962
    address  3Kkbg1LRBDchd295mtPkUNm76VYDiU22ds